Understanding Technoligarchy

Technoligarchy is the intersection of technological innovation and concentrated power. As technology giants become more influential, they shape societal norms, economies, and even politics. These tech titans hold substantial control over information dissemination, commerce, and communication, thus reshaping the world’s power dynamics. Here are the key components:
